Introduction:
Neurotransmitters are the chemical messengers that are synthesized by the neural fibers and the endocrine glands to elicit the secondary response or stimuli to the target organ sites. Mostly, these neurotransmitters are acetylcholine, norepinephrine, and neuropeptides. In which, norepinephrine is termed as emergency hormone that is secreted by the adrenal gland majorly and by some neural cells to some extent. Norepinephrine (NE) once it has been synthesized and has completed its desired function, it will be degraded in the synaptic cleft of neural cells by the specialized enzymes namely monoamine oxidase (MAO) and catechol-o-methyltransferase (COMT).
